Lets take your money and crew the tower at Avalon Mr Smith.

We need how many controllers? Three, maybe four to cover days off, lunch breaks etc. Where are we going to get them?; lets pull them from Melbourne, Essendon and Moorabbin seeing as they live close to Avalon.

Wait a minute, I seem to recall the phrase "Melbourne clearance delivery and ground frequencies combined due staff shortage, expect delays" Broadcast on the Melbourne ATIS.

Now, boys and girls, I believe that if we are having trouble employing staff for the major international towers where the passenger numbers per year are many, many times Avalon's capacity, that is a more major safety concern than the tower at Avalon.

If you want to do something worthwhile with your money Mr Smith I suggest looking at ways to improve the training intake at Airservices Australia.
